Bringing Intelligence to the Edge: Applications and Benefits of Edge AI

Edge artificial intelligence (AI) is revolutionizing domains by enabling intelligent processing directly on devices at the edge of a network. This decentralized approach offers notable advantages over traditional cloud-based AI, including reduced latency, enhanced privacy, and improved reliability.

Applications of edge AI are numerous, spanning fields such as smart devices, autonomous vehicles, industrial automation, and real-time analysis. By processing data locally, edge AI empowers faster decision-making, enabling applications that require immediate action.

Furthermore, edge AI helps to protect sensitive data by keeping it within the device, minimizing the risk of breaches and improving privacy. The durability of edge AI systems is another key benefit, as they can operate reliably even in remote environments with limited or intermittent connectivity.
